“When you get older, you do it with purpose,” says Marlon Wayans in an exclusive interview, reflecting on his evolving relationship with cannabis. The multi-talented actor, comedian, and producer, known for his iconic roles in weed-forward films like “Scary Movie” and “Don’t Be a Menace to South Central While Drinking Your Juice in the Hood,” has seen his use of cannabis transition from youthful experimentation to a purposeful part of his lifestyle.

He openly shares how his perspective has matured over the years. “When you’re younger, you just smoke because you like smoking; you want to get high and be with your friends,” he explains. “When you get older, it’s like, okay, I’m gonna do this strain because I want to just relax right now. I want this kind of weed because I just want to chill right now and have some fun.” This evolution mirrors the broader societal shift towards understanding and embracing the multifaceted uses of cannabis, beyond mere recreation.
